Bessent urges G20 to ‘get back to the basics’ with deregulation and growth-first agenda

ASHEVILLE, N.C. –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ent delivered a firm call to action to global financial leaders in his opening remarks at the G20 Finance Track meetings on Monday, urging the group to refocus on driving “stronger and more durable growth” by dismantling government-imposed economic barriers.

Speaking at the gathering of finance ministers and central bank governors, Bessent framed the U.S. presidency of the G20 around a “back-to-basics” approach to economic policy, arguing that global growth has underperformed for far too long.

“Many forces can inhibit economic growth,” Bessent said in his opening remarks. “But policy failures of our own making must no longer be one of them.”

Bessent outlined a comprehensive list of drag factors identified by the G20 finance track that hamper global expansion. Among the key bottlenecks named were excessive regulatory burdens, poorly designed tax systems, internal market fragmentation, lagging public and private investment, and persistent gaps in workforce mobility.

“I think we’re already seeing a lot of these leading indicators that we’ve been talking about, for instance, robust factory construction growth. In order to have factory jobs, you need factories to be constructed first,” White House senior deputy press secretary Kush Desai told FOX Business, regarding the U.S. economy. “And so far, this president has added tens of thousands of factory construction jobs.”

To counter these challenges, Bessent presented the Trump administration’s domestic policy model as a blueprint for foreign counterparts. Highlighting what he termed a “great regulatory reset,” Bessent pointed to aggressive deregulatory measures aimed at stimulating investment and boosting wages. He noted that federal agencies drastically surpassed the administration’s initial goal of eliminating 10 existing regulations for every new one issued, achieving a 129-to-1 reduction ratio over the past year.

International Monetary Fund Managing Director Kristalina Georgieva used the U.S. model as an example of the right policy to attract business. She told FOX Business at the Federal Reserve’s Jackson Hole Symposium that “You realize that here, 2.5% a year. You go to Europe, it is zero. You go to Japan, half a percentage point. Because of this entrepreneurial environment and the commitment to eliminate red tape, so businesses can flourish.”

U.S. Pitch to International Partners

Bessent pitched the U.S. as the premier global destination for capital, citing historic tax relief for working families and energy independence as primary drivers for the next era of economic expansion.

He also commended international partners for pursuing ambitious reform programs of their own to engage the private sector and spur market activity, welcoming collaborative feedback as discussions continue over the two-day summit.

The Asheville meetings mark a critical milestone in the U.S. host year for the G20, setting the stage for the Leaders’ Summit in Florida later this year. Discussions will continue through Tuesday, focusing on structural reform, global financial stability and private sector investment.
